Coleman Cable, Inc. (Coleman) is a designer, developer, manufacturer and supplier of electrical wire and cable products for consumer, commercial and industrial applications, with operations primarily in the United States and in Honduras and Canada. The Company’s wire and cable products enable it to offer its customers a single source for many of their wire and cable product requirements. It manufactures its products in 10 domestic manufacturing locations and supplement its domestic production with both international and domestic sourcing. It sells its products to more than 8,000 active customers in end markets. It operates in three segments: Distribution, OEM, and Other. On April 1, 2011, the Company acquired The Designers Edge. On April 29, 2011, the Company acquired certain assets of First Capitol Wire and Cable (FCWC) and Continental Wire and Cable (CWC). On May 16, 2011, the Company acquired Technology Research Corporation (TRC). In May 2012, the Company acquired Watteredge, Inc.
